Transaction 555ec161d7f84c9259d72b90a01896d521bc164abdd655fddf418f217106a47c
1 Input
2 Outputs
- 555ec161d7f84c9259d72b90a01896d521bc164abdd655fddf418f217106a47c:0
- 555ec161d7f84c9259d72b90a01896d521bc164abdd655fddf418f217106a47c:1
value 105180559
address 136SsqAcFTS5ioJpVx3WBKhNdFs4pUXe7n
value 26490052
address 3DmYssMo9aoRfPmtqdeTrbFqqp2ADcCx3N